/**
* An {@link ITransactionalOperation} to bend an {@link IBendableContentPart}.
*
* @author anyssen
*
*/
public class BendContentOperation extends AbstractOperation
implements ITransactionalOperation {
private final IBendableContentPart<? extends Node> bendableContentPart;
private List<BendPoint> initialBendPoints;
private List<BendPoint> finalBendPoints;
/**
* Creates a new {@link BendContentOperation} to resize the content of the
* given {@link IResizableContentPart}.
*
* @param bendableContentPart
* The part to bend.
* @param initialBendPoints
* The initial bend points before applying the change.
* @param finalBendPoints
* The final bend points after applying the change.
*/
public BendContentOperation(
IBendableContentPart<? extends Node> bendableContentPart,
List<BendPoint> initialBendPoints,
List<BendPoint> finalBendPoints) {
super("Bend Content");
this.bendableContentPart = bendableContentPart;
this.initialBendPoints = initialBendPoints;
this.finalBendPoints = finalBendPoints;
}
@Override
public IStatus execute(IProgressMonitor monitor, IAdaptable info)
throws ExecutionException {
// TODO (bug #493515): retrieve current bend points from
// bendableContentPart and only
// call bendContent if a change occurred.
bendableContentPart.setContentBendPoints(finalBendPoints);
// TODO: validate bending worked
return Status.OK_STATUS;
}
@Override
public boolean isContentRelevant() {
return true;
}
@Override
public boolean isNoOp() {
return initialBendPoints == null ? finalBendPoints == null
: initialBendPoints.equals(finalBendPoints);
}
@Override
public IStatus redo(IProgressMonitor monitor, IAdaptable info)
throws ExecutionException {
return execute(monitor, info);
}
@Override
public IStatus undo(IProgressMonitor monitor, IAdaptable info)
throws ExecutionException {
// TODO (bug #493515): retrieve current bend points from
// bendableContentPart and only
// call bendContent if a change occurred.
bendableContentPart.setContentBendPoints(initialBendPoints);
// TODO: validate bending worked
return Status.OK_STATUS;
}
}
